php7怎么升级
-
要升级到PHP 7,可以按照以下步骤进行操作:
1. 检查系统要求:首先,确保你的服务器或开发环境满足PHP 7的系统要求。PHP 7需要至少PHP 5.5.9版本的运行环境以及一些额外的系统库支持。可以通过运行命令“`php -v“`来查看当前安装的PHP版本。
2. 备份现有代码和数据:在进行任何升级操作之前,务必备份你的现有代码和数据。这样可以在出现问题时恢复到原始状态。
3. 升级PHP版本:升级PHP最方便的方法是使用包管理工具。对于Ubuntu和Debian系统,可以使用以下命令:
“`
sudo apt update
sudo apt upgrade php
“`
对于CentOS和Red Hat系统,可以使用以下命令:
“`
sudo yum update
sudo yum upgrade php
“`
如果你使用的是Windows系统,可以下载最新的PHP二进制文件并进行手动安装。4. 检查和更新代码:一些旧版本的PHP代码可能不兼容PHP 7的一些变化。你需要仔细检查你的代码,并根据需要进行更新。一些常见的变化包括移除不推荐使用的函数和特性,以及对一些错误处理和语法的更改。
5. 测试和调试:在升级完成后,需要进行全面的测试和调试,以确保代码在PHP 7上正常运行。可以使用像PHPUnit和Xdebug这样的工具来帮助你进行测试和调试。
6. 性能优化:PHP 7相比较之前的版本有很多性能优化,你可以利用这些优化来提升应用程序的性能。可以使用像OPcache这样的缓存工具来加速PHP脚本的执行。
总结起来,升级到PHP 7需要先检查系统要求,备份现有代码和数据,然后使用包管理工具进行升级,检查和更新代码,进行测试和调试,并进行性能优化。
2年前 -
对于php7的升级,可以按照以下步骤进行:
1. 检查系统要求:首先,你需要确认你的系统是否满足php7的要求。php7对操作系统的要求比较高,需要至少是Windows 7、Windows Server 2008 R2、Mac OS X 10.10、或者Linux Kernel 3.10以上版本。
2.备份现有文件:升级过程可能会影响现有的php文件,所以在升级之前,务必备份好你的现有php文件和数据库。这样,在升级过程中遇到问题时,可以还原到之前的状态。
3. 下载和安装php7:你可以从官方网站(www.php.net/downloads.php)上下载php7的最新版本。选择符合你系统要求的安装包进行下载,并按照官方指导进行安装。
4. 修改配置文件:在安装完成之后,你需要修改php.ini文件,以确保php7可以正常工作。在这个文件中,你需要修改一些参数,比如error_reporting、display_errors、以及date.timezone等。根据你的需求,可以参考官方文档来进行配置。
5. 测试和调试:升级完成后,你需要测试你的php应用是否可以正常工作。可以使用一些简单的php脚本,比如输出php版本信息,查询数据库等。如果发现有错误或者异常,可以通过调试工具来进行定位和修复。
在升级过程中,还需要注意以下几点:
1. 了解php7的新特性:php7有许多新特性和改进,比如更高的性能、更低的内存消耗、更好的错误处理等。在升级之前,可以先了解一下这些新特性,并根据实际情况来决定是否需要使用它们。
2. 更新扩展和框架:升级到php7可能会导致现有的扩展和框架不兼容。在进行升级之前,先检查你使用的扩展和框架是否有php7的版本,并升级到最新的版本。
3. 监控性能:升级到php7后,你可能会发现应用的性能有所提升。但是,这并不意味着你可以不关注性能问题了。相反,你应该继续监控你的应用,以确保它能够保持良好的性能。
4. 定期更新:php7会不断发布新的版本,修复一些bug和安全漏洞。所以,在升级之后,你应该定期检查官方网站,下载并安装最新的php7版本。
5. 寻求帮助:如果你在升级过程中遇到问题,可以寻求帮助。可以使用官方文档、社区论坛、或者请教其他php开发者。记住,你不是一个人在战斗,有很多人都已经经历过php7的升级,他们可能能够给你一些有用的建议。
综上所述,升级php7并不是一件复杂的事情,只要按照上述步骤进行,你就可以成功地将你的应用升级到php7,并享受到更好的性能和功能。
2年前 -
升级PHP7并非一件复杂的任务,只需按照以下方法操作流程即可完成。
第一步:备份
在升级之前,务必备份您当前的PHP环境以防止数据丢失。备份可以分为两部分:数据库备份和文件备份。数据库备份可以使用数据库管理工具如phpMyAdmin,文件备份可以使用FTP或者其他文件管理工具。第二步:检查系统要求
在升级之前,要确保您的系统满足PHP7的最低要求。PHP7要求的最低版本是:PHP5.5.9(推荐使用PHP5.6及以上版本)。另外,也要确保您的服务器满足PHP7的硬件要求。第三步:下载并安装PHP7
您可以从PHP的官方网站(https://www.php.net/downloads.php)下载PHP7的最新版本。选择适合您系统的二进制文件并下载。在下载完成后,将其解压到一个目录中。第四步:配置和编译
进入解压后的PHP7目录,找到一个名为”configure”的文件并运行它。该命令将会检查您系统的配置和依赖项是否满足PHP7的要求,如有问题会给出相应提示。如果运行成功,会生成一个”Makefile”文件。接下来,运行”make”命令进行编译。这个过程可能需要一些时间,具体取决于您的系统配置和硬件性能。
第五步:安装PHP7
编译成功后,运行”make install”命令进行安装。该命令将会将PHP7安装到系统的默认目录中。如果您希望将其安装到其他目录,可以通过修改”configure”文件来指定安装路径。第六步:配置PHP7
在安装完毕后,需要对PHP7进行一些配置。进入PHP的安装目录,找到一个名为”php.ini”的文件,将其复制到正确的配置文件夹中(可以通过运行”php –ini”命令来查看)。然后根据您的需求进行一些配置,如调整内存限制、启用扩展等。第七步:启动和测试
完成以上步骤后,您可以启动您的Web服务器并测试PHP7是否正常工作。可以访问一个包含以下代码的PHP文件进行测试:将该文件放置在Web服务器的目录中,并通过浏览器访问它,如果您看到了PHP7的信息页面,则表明升级成功。
总结
升级PHP7并不复杂,但仍然需要一定的操作和配置。在升级之前,请确保备份当前环境,检查系统要求,并按照上述步骤进行操作。升级成功后,您将能够享受到PHP7的新特性和性能提升。2年前